1940's Homer Laughlin Bristol SET of 4 Fruit ( Dessert) Bowls
Manufactured in the 1940's by Homer Laughlin, the Bristol pattern won the American Vogue award. The periwinkle blue and pink florals (possibly pink wild roses and blue forget me nots)are a beautiful contrast against the creamy ivory background. Bristol was created in at least two of Laughlin's shapes; the Eggshell Nautilus Shape (like these) and also in Laughlin's Georgian shape.
